The Rise of Electric Three-Wheeler Scooters: A Sustainable and Efficient Transport Solution
Recently, urban transport has actually gone through a significant transformation as cities try to tackle the growing problems of contamination, traffic blockage, and transportation ineffectiveness. One solution that has actually gotten traction is the electric three-wheeler scooter. Integrating the dexterity of a scooter with the stability of a three-wheeler, this ingenious transportation choice provides various benefits for both commuters and services. This post will explore the functions, benefits, and possible drawbacks of electric three-wheeler scooters while supplying contrasts and responding to frequently asked questions.
Comprehending Electric Three-Wheeler Scooters
Electric three-wheeler scooters are compact, battery-powered automobiles developed for short-distance travel. They generally feature one front wheel and 2 rear wheels, using improved stability and convenience than conventional two-wheeled scooters. They are particularly popular in congested urban locations due to their small footprint and capability to browse narrow streets and rush hour effectively.
Table 1: Key Features of Electric Three-Wheeler Scooters
| Function | Description |
|---|---|
| Motor Power | 1kW to 10kW |
| Battery Type | Lithium-ion or Lead-acid |
| Range per Charge | 50 to 100 kilometers |
| Top Speed | 25 to 60 kilometers per hour (kph) |
| Seating Capacity | 2 to 4 travelers |
| Weight | 200 to 400 kilograms |
| Charging Time | 4 to 8 hours |
| Price Range | ₤ 2,000 to ₤ 6,000 |
Advantages of Electric Three-Wheeler Scooters
Ecological Friendliness
Among the most substantial benefits of electric three-wheeler scooters is their low environmental effect. Powered by batteries, they produce zero tailpipe emissions, which assists enhance air quality in urban locations and adds to the fight against climate modification. As more cities carry out rigid emissions policies, these scooters represent a greener option for transporting people and products.
Cost-Effectiveness
Running an electric three-wheeler scooter is significantly less expensive than traditional gas-powered lorries. Owners save on fuel costs, as electricity charges are normally lower than fuel costs. Additionally, the upkeep expenses are minimized due to fewer moving parts and the lack of an internal combustion engine, leading to less wear and tear.
Traffic Efficiency
Electric three-wheelers can quickly navigate through crowded metropolitan environments. Their compact size enables them to park in tight areas, minimizing the opportunities of traffic jams triggered by bigger cars. Additionally, the ability to operate in bike lanes and devoted pathways can cause quicker travel times, making them an attractive alternative for everyday commuters.
Versatility
These scooters can accommodate various transport needs, from individual commutes to business functions such as shipment services and little cargo transportation. Operators can benefit from the versatility that electric three-wheelers offer, allowing them to customize their vehicles to satisfy specific requirements.
Peaceful Operation
An electric motor releases significantly less noise than a traditional combustion engine. This serene operation results in a decrease in sound pollution, adding to a more pleasant city environment.
Safety Features
The majority of modern electric three-wheeler scooters come equipped with innovative safety functions, including anti-lock brake systems, stability control, and LED lighting. These functions contribute to a safer riding experience, especially for novice users.
Possible Drawbacks
While electric three-wheeler scooters offer numerous benefits, they are not without their challenges. Here are some possible disadvantages to consider:
Range Anxiety: Although innovation has improved substantially, battery range can still be a concern for users who require to travel longer ranges. With varieties between 50 to 100 kilometers, commuters must plan their trips appropriately.
Battery Lifespan: Battery degradation takes place with time, affecting efficiency and range. Users require to be knowledgeable about battery upkeep and replacement needs to guarantee optimal performance.
Preliminary Costs: The upfront expenses for electric three-wheelers can be greater than standard scooters. Although long-term cost savings may be acquired, the preliminary investment can hinder some purchasers.
Facilities Needs: In some regions, a lack of appropriate charging infrastructure can make electric three-wheelers less viable. Broadening this facilities is crucial for the prevalent adoption of these vehicles.

Frequently Asked Questions (FAQ)
1. How quickly can electric three-wheeler scooters go?
The top speed of electric three-wheeler scooters normally ranges from 25 to 60 kilometers per hour, depending upon the model and motor power.
2. The length of time does it require to charge an electric three-wheeler scooter?
Charging times can vary based upon the battery type and capacity. Many electric three-wheelers take between 4 to 8 hours for a complete charge.
3. What is the typical series of electric three-wheeler scooters?
Normally, electric three-wheelers have a series of 50 to 100 kilometers on a single charge, depending upon aspects such as weight, terrain, and driving speed.
4. Are electric three-wheeler scooters safe?
Modern electric three-wheelers are equipped with innovative security features, making them a safe choice for city transportation compared to conventional two-wheeled scooters.
5. Can electric three-wheeler scooters be utilized for commercial purposes?
Yes, numerous businesses utilize electric three-wheelers for delivery services, little cargo transport, and ridesharing operations due to their flexibility and cost-effectiveness.
